The soul then undergoes rebirth in relation to the karma it has accumulated. Hindus believe that the soul passes through a cycle of successive lives (samsara) and its next incarnation is always dependent on how the previous life was lived (karma). Hinduism accepts the concept of reincarnation, and what determines the state of an individual in the next existence is karma which refers to the actions undertaken by the body and the mind. Hinduism is the world’s oldest religion, according to many scholars, with roots and customs dating back more than 4,000 years.
